  • Bloom rooms
    High on the wish lists of budding florists and gardeners, the trend for ‘flower rooms’ is blossoming. While dedicating a whole room is a luxury, setting aside space for cutting and arranging blooms is within reach of most homes. A folding table (by a sink) offers flexibility, while wall hooks are handy for baskets, trays and trugs. Make a feature of pretty vases and pots on open shelves.
